, A uniform rod of mass m and length / is held inclined at an angle of 600 with the vertical. What will-be potential energy of the rod in this position ?

a

m g I

b

m g I/2

c

m g I/3

d

m g I /4

answer is D.

Detailed Solution

See fig. (12). Let the center of gravity of the rod be at aheight ft. From figure,h=OCsin⁡30∘=(l/2)sin⁡30∘=l/4  P.E. =mgh=mgl/4
